    Eddie Hearn:
    "We have had so many offers this week - Nigeria, Dubai, America, and also we have the opportunity of Cardiff here in the UK. Financially, Cardiff's not the best choice, but also at the same time, if it's not broke don't fix it, and we have that mentality with 'AJ' moving forward."

    Edit:
    IBF have said the fight must happen before December 2nd...this may put Cardiff out the equation as Principality Stadium is only available in December.
